Buying Secondhand Cutting Tools : A Purchaser's Manual

Venturing into the area of used cutting machinery can be a shrewd move for shops looking to save expenditures, but it requires careful assessment . Consider the tool's provenance; inquire about maintenance documentation . Inspect for visible deterioration and confirm the brand is established. Lastly , weigh rates from several sellers before concluding your acquisition .

Understanding Cutting Tool Design Principles

To optimally produce high-quality components, a cutting tool design principles is critically vital. The geometry of a cutting tool – including its angle & its profile – directly impacts its operation. Several materials necessitate specific cutting edge features, including hardness , attrition resistance , and heat stability . Consequently , meticulous consideration of these factors is crucial for realizing optimal outcomes in fabrication processes .
